The Samsung Trance is a qualcomm phone, so the ringtones use the .qcp format - I'm thinking you need software to convert from .mp3 to .qcp. To find conversion software, try doing a search at Softpedia or Cnet Downloads using the keyword "qcp". Once you have ringtones in the correct .qcp format, the phone should theoretically recognize them. You could also try BitPim (also available on Softpedia) which is a GPL open source program designed to work with Qualcomm phones - I don't know if it will work with the Trance, but it may be worth trying. Just be sure to read the fine print on this program so you don't end up bricking your phone! Good luck.
